<sidebar>API Contents</sidebar> Adds an operation to act on the inputs of the stream

Class hierarchy

Scope

AddOp

Parameters

HANDLE StreamH

A handle to a previously created datascope stream

ULONG FuncOp

An operation to perform on the input
Typical values for this parameter:
Name Description
Op_Bound Bound the current value to the expected range of the input
Op_Scale Divide the current value to the expected range of the input
Op_Xor Exclusive-or with the provided integer argument
Op_AndNot Clear the bits in the provided integer argument
Op_And Isolate only the bits in the provided integer argument
Op_Orr Set the bits in the provided integer argument
Op_Not Invert (ones-compliment) the current input
Op_Add Add the argument to the current input
Op_Sub Subtract the argument from the current input
Op_Mul Multiply the argument by the current input
Op_Div Divide the current input by the argument
Op_Pow Raise the input to the power of the argument
Op_Neg Negate (twos compliment) the current input
Op_Recip Perform the reciprocal on the current input
Op_Sqrt Perform a square root on the current input
Op_Ln Perform a natural logarithm on the current input
Op_Ln2 Perform a base-2 logarithm on the current input
Op_Cos Convert the input to its cosine value (input is in radians)
Op_Sin Convert the input to its sine value (input is in radians)
Op_Tan Convert the input to its tangent value (input is in radians)
Op_Int Convert the input from a float to an integer (using the floor function)

FLOAT Arg

An optional argument that may be used by the FuncOp
The default value for this parameter is: 0


Return value

BOOL

Returns true if the operation is a success, else false

Examples

Calling in a calculation

  • Declare a variable 'result' of type BOOL
  • Add to a calculation icon:
    result = ::Scope.AddOp(streamh, ::Scope.Op_Bound, arg)
